What affects the price

When you look at garage door repairs, the total cost depends on a few moving parts. The main factors are the type of door you have, the specific hardware that failed, and the complexity of the labor involved. For example, replacing a single heavy-duty spring is a different job than repairing a damaged track or an opener motor that has burned out. What is involved in garage door spring repair?

Garage door spring repair in Tampa involves safely releasing the tension on a broken or worn spring and installing a new one that's correctly sized for your door. Because these springs are under extreme tension, this task requires specialized tools and expertise to perform safely. What is the process for replacing a garage door bottom seal?

Replacing a garage door bottom seal involves removing the old seal from the bottom of the door and installing a new one, typically made of rubber or vinyl.
